Cambridge Street School
Cambridge Street School is an independent school in Batley for boys aged 11 to 19. It has 177 pupils and room for 180.

Results
GCSE results, summer 2025
35 pupils sat their GCSEs. Here is how they did against every state secondary in England.
All GCSE measures, year by year
| Measure | 2025 | 2024 | 2023 | 2022 | 2019 | 2018 | Kirklees | England |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| Pupils at the end of Year 11 | 35 | 22 | 27 | 17 | 8 | 6 | – | – |
| Average GCSE scoreAttainment 8 | 24.9 | 20.2 | 27.4 | 30.5 | 38.5 | 32.2 | 46.6 | 46.8 |
| Strong pass in English and mathsGrade 5+ in English and maths | 20% | 9% | 15% | 65% | 13% | 17% | 46% | 46% |
| Standard pass in English and mathsGrade 4+ in English and maths | 37% | 32% | 44% | 65% | 38% | 17% | 66% | 66% |
| Core subjects scoreEBacc average point score | 1.95 | 1.66 | 2.44 | 2.64 | 3.65 | 3.05 | 4.07 | 4.15 |
| Taking the core subjectsEBacc entry | 3% | 0% | 4% | 6% | 0% | 0% | 36% | 41% |
Subjects
Results came out for 8 GCSE subjects in 2025. Each figure is the share of pupils who got a grade 5 or better, next to the average for state secondaries in England.
Subjects that did worse than the England average: Social Studies (22% here, 54% across England), English Language (30% here, 54% across England), Business (27% here, 51% across England), Mathematics (30% here, 53% across England).
The small number is how many pupils sat each subject. Subjects with fewer than six pupils aren't published.
Every subject against England, 2025
| Subject | Entries | Grades 9 to 7 | Grades 9 to 5 | Grades 9 to 4 | England 9 to 5 | Rank in England |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| Mathematics | 33 | 0% | 30% | 55% | 53% | – |
| English Language | 30 | 3% | 30% | 53% | 54% | – |
| Combined Science | 24 | 4% | 25% | 50% | 36% | – |
| Social Studies | 18 | 6% | 22% | 56% | 54% | – |
| Religious Studies | 18 | 11% | 61% | 72% | 60% | – |
| Business | 15 | 7% | 27% | 40% | 51% | – |
| Geography | 12 | 8% | 25% | 25% | 51% | – |
| English Literature | 6 | 0% | 17% | 50% | 58% | – |
In combined science each pupil gets two grades and we count the lower one. Rankings only include state secondaries where 20 or more pupils sat the subject.

How good are Cambridge Street School's GCSE results?
In summer 2025, 20% of pupils got a grade 5 or better in both English and maths. Across England it was 46%. Its Attainment 8 score, which is the average grade across a pupil's best eight subjects times ten, was 24.9, against 46.8 for England.
How many pupils does Cambridge Street School have?
177 pupils aged 11 to 19 were on the roll in January 2024. It has 180 places, so it is 98% full. It is a boys' school.
